Answer:

y = -3/2x + 3

Explanation:

We can get 2 points from the graph

(0,3)

(2,0)

from (0,3) we know that the b in the equation is 3

now to calculate m or slope we use
(y1-y2)/(x1-x2)


(0 - 3)/(2-0) = -3/2

so we plug our m and b into y = mx + b and get

y = -3/2x + 3
